Maya is an amazing dog that was rescued from death row in Arlington, TX. When rescued she was emaciated and had obviously just had a litter that was not picked up by animal services. Despite her condition she was loving, sweet and very hungry! She has filled out, although still a little thin, and is just stunning. She is a shy girl that loves hugs and kisses, is great with dogs and kids. The Carolina Dog Rescue and Conservation Project was created to protect the free-ranging Carolina Dog.
We have several pervasive goals
1.Provide a hub for prospective adoptive families to find Carolina Dogs in need of homes
2.Locate populations of free-ranging Carolina Dogs in the American southeast.
3.Raise awareness and educate the public about these rare and elusive native dogs.
We have a beautiful 10 acre facility in Caldwell, TX dedicated to the rehabilitation and preservation of Carolina Dogs and other primitive breeds.
We require a contract as well as an adoption fee and screening. A fenced yard and exercise is a must.
We are a resue group for Carolina Dogs, our U.S. Dingo. We adopt nationwide.
